  • P106 090 is connected by PCIe 3.0 x16, and Radeon R8 M365DX uses IGP interface.
  • P106 090 is used in Desktops, and Radeon R8 M365DX - in Laptops.
  • P106 090 is build with Pascal architecture, and Radeon R8 M365DX - with GCN.
  • Core clock speed of P106 090 is 634 MHz higher, than Radeon R8 M365DX.
  • P106 090 is manufactured by 16 nm process technology, and Radeon R8 M365DX - by 28 nm process technology.
  • Memory clock speed of P106 090 is 7208 MHz higher, than Radeon R8 M365DX.
